Watch this guy crush a game of cornhole on a moving car

At some point in your life, you’ve probably played cornhole. You toss 16-ounce bags of corn kernels into a board with a hole in the end. Typically, you play until someone scores 21 points, and while the game does involve some serious hand-eye coordination, one player thought they could up the stakes a bit. 

Self-described cornhole addict Dano, who goes by washedupwarrior on Instagram, posts tons of videos of his cornhole trick shots. It doesn’t matter if it’s through a hoop on a roof or bouncing off an obstacle, Dano seemingly never misses. Sports Illustrated even gave one of his stunts a shout out on Instagram

The cornhole board is on top of a moving van in this trick. Dano is able to hit the board with the first three throws as the vehicle drives further away. But when he tosses his final sack, it thrusts all four of the bags into the hole. Masterful!

Cornhole has been around so long, its origins are largely shrouded in mystery. However, some believe 14th-century cabinet maker Matthias Kuepermann invented it. Allegedly, he saw some children tossing rocks in a groundhog’s hole and came up with a safer version of the game. Now hundreds of years later, it’s still a favorite pastime.
